`

oracle中角色

阅读更多
1. oracle角色
角色是权限的集合,可以给用户直接分配角色,不需要一个一个分配权限。
常用的预定义角色connect,resource,dba。

查看角色权限
SQL> select * from dba_sys_privs where grantee='DBA';

查询所有预定义角色
SQL> select * from dba_roles;

查询用户具有角色
select * from dba_role_privs where grantee='SYS';

创建用户赋角色
SQL> create user andrew identified by andrew;
SQL> grant connect,resource to andrew;

SQL> grant select on scott.emp to andrew;

创建角色
create role 角色名称;

建立角色不验证
create role 角色名 not identified;
SQL> create role crud_scott not identified;

建立角色需数据库验证
create role 角色名 identified by 口令;
分享到:
评论

相关推荐

    oracle系统自带角色说明

    IMP_FULL_DATABASE角色则包含了导入数据到数据库的必要权限,如`EXP_FULL_DATABASE`角色中的权限以及`CREATE ANY TABLE`等额外的系统权限。这些权限确保了拥有该角色的用户可以在数据库中创建新表并导入数据。 ####...

    oracle角色大全信息

    本文将深入探讨Oracle角色大全信息,包括角色的类型、创建、分配、撤销以及常见内置角色的详细说明。 一、角色类型 1. 体系结构角色(System Role):由Oracle提供,具有系统级别的权限,例如DBA角色,拥有对数据库...

    Oracle创建系统角色DBA

    在Oracle数据库中,系统角色是预定义的一组权限集合,它们为数据库管理员(DBA)提供了方便的方式来管理和分配权限。DBA角色是最具权限的角色之一,通常赋予那些负责数据库全面管理的用户。当误删除了这个关键角色时...

    10 oracle管理权限和角色 PPT

    管理员可以创建一个角色,将相关的权限赋予该角色,然后将角色授予用户,这样用户就拥有了角色中包含的所有权限。角色可以是公共的,对所有用户开放,也可以是私有的,只对特定用户授予。 3. 授予权限(Granting ...

    Oracle用户权限角色设置

    Oracle用户权限角色设置,用来在新建的数据库中添加新的用户,并为其设置权限。

    Oracle权限、角色和用户1

    4. **EXP_FULL_DATABASE和IMP_FULL_DATABASE角色**:这两个角色特指数据导入导出操作,分别用于卸出和装入整个数据库,这在数据备份和迁移过程中非常关键。 权限管理分为系统权限和实体权限两大类: **系统权限**...

    Toad for Oracle 12.8简体中文语言包

    在Oracle数据库管理系统中,Toad for Oracle扮演着至关重要的角色。它简化了SQL编写,提供了代码自动完成和语法高亮,使得数据库操作更为高效。用户可以通过其用户友好的界面来浏览数据库结构、执行查询、管理用户...

    浅析Oracle中的角色与权限.pdf

    本文主要探讨了Oracle数据库中的角色和权限管理,这是确保数据库安全的关键机制。 在Oracle数据库中,角色(Role)是一个非常重要的概念,它允许数据库管理员以更高效的方式管理和控制用户的访问权限。当数据库规模...

    Oracle数据库中的角色管理.pdf

    Oracle数据库中的角色管理是一项重要的安全管理机制,它允许数据库管理员有效地管理和分配权限给大量具有相似权限需求的用户。角色(Role)是Oracle数据库中的一种安全主体,它们类似于Windows操作系统中的用户组,...

    oracle权限及角色.doc

    角色是一组权限的集合,它可以被赋予一个或多个用户,使得用户获得角色中定义的所有权限。这样,当有一组用户需要相同的权限时,只需一次性地管理角色,而不是逐个管理用户权限。例如,如果你有一个开发团队,所有...

    Oracle创建删除用户、角色、表空间、导入导出.命令总结

    Oracle创建删除用户、角色、表空间、导入导出.命令总结 从中可以学到很多oracle的知识。尤其针对入门者

    oracle 用户、权限和角色管理

    oracle 用户、权限和角色管理,oracle 人员必看。

    Oracle用户角色及权限管理.docx

    Oracle数据库的用户角色及权限管理是数据库管理员(DBA)日常工作中不可或缺的部分,它涉及到数据库的安全性和访问控制。本文将详细阐述Oracle中的用户、角色和权限的概念以及如何进行管理。 首先,Oracle数据库中...

    Oracle数据库中文手册

    Oracle数据库是全球广泛使用的大型关系型数据库管理系统,尤其在企业级应用中占据着重要的地位。这份"Oracle数据库中文手册"提供了全面的Oracle管理知识,帮助读者深入理解和掌握Oracle数据库的各项功能和操作技巧。...

    Oracle中文教程(最经典教程)

    Oracle数据库是全球广泛使用的大型关系型数据库管理系统,尤其在企业级应用中占据主导地位。本“Oracle中文教程(最经典教程)”旨在为不同水平的学习者提供深入浅出的指导,帮助他们掌握Oracle数据库的核心概念、管理...

    通过MSQL通过视图访问ORACLE中的表

    在IT行业中,数据库管理系统(DBMS)如MySQL和Oracle在数据存储和管理方面扮演着重要角色。当企业或组织需要整合来自不同DBMS的数据时,跨数据库查询技术就显得尤为重要。本篇主要介绍如何通过MySQL数据库创建视图来...

    oracle权限角色

    Oracle权限和角色是数据库管理中的核心概念,它们用于控制用户对数据库对象的访问和操作。在Oracle数据库系统中,权限允许用户执行特定的操作,而角色则是一组预定义的权限集合,可以方便地分配给多个用户。 1. ...

    oracle数据库中的角色管理.pdf

    Oracle 数据库中的角色管理是权限控制的一个重要方面,它允许管理员高效地管理和分配数据库权限。角色扮演着权限集合的角色,可以被授予用户或者其他的角色,从而简化了权限的分配和管理流程。 首先,角色的定义是...

    oracle中的BLOB(照片)转换到mysql中

    在IT行业中,数据库管理系统(DBMS)如Oracle和MySQL在数据存储方面扮演着至关重要的角色。Oracle数据库系统支持多种复杂的数据类型,其中包括BLOB(Binary Large Object),用于存储非结构化的大数据,如图片、音频...

    OracleMembershipProvider asp.net角色管理的oracle版本

    在描述中提到的"asp.net角色管理的oracle版本",意味着这个解决方案专门针对使用Oracle数据库的ASP.NET应用,提供了与角色相关的功能。角色管理是安全控制的一部分,它允许管理员将用户分组到不同的角色,然后根据...

Global site tag (gtag.js) - Google Analytics